What companies run services between Exeter, England and Weybridge, England?

South Western Railway operates a train from Exeter Central to Woking hourly. Tickets cost £55–140 and the journey takes 2h 45m. Alternatively, Loganair, British Airways, and two other airlines fly from Exeter (EXT) to London Heathrow Airport (LHR) 4 times a day.
